Bahraini Doctors Who Treated Anti -Government Protesters Face Trial

DUBAI, United Arab Emirates -- Dozens of doctors and nurses who treated injured anti-government protesters during the months of unrest in Bahrain went on trial in a security court on Monday on allegations they participated in efforts to overthrow the Gulf country's monarchy.The prosecution of 47 health professionals is a sign that Bahrain's Sunni rulers will not end their relentless pursuit of the Shiite-led opposition despite officially lifting emergency rule last week.The doctors and nurses were arraigned on Monday during a closed hearing in a security court authorized under emergency rule that was imposed in mid-March to crush weeks of demonstrations by Bahrain's Shiite majority, which has campaigned for greater freedoms, equal rights and an elected government. The court has military prosecutors and military and civilian judges.The medical workers were charged with participating in efforts to topple Bahrain's Sunni monarchy and taking part in illegal rallies.
